TOKYO, May 12 (Pulse News Wire) – Enshu Truck CO.,LTD. (9057.T) announced today that its board of directors has approved several personnel changes effective June 24, 2026.
The formal decisions are expected to be finalized during the company's 61st Annual General Meeting scheduled for June 24, followed by subsequent board meetings. Among the key appointments, Masaya Arakawa will join as a new auditor, replacing Seiji Homma who is set to retire. Additionally, Arakawa will take up a position as Director of Related Business Operations at Sumitomo Warehouse Co., Ltd. on June 25, 2026, while Homma will transition to the role of Director of Accounting at Sumitomo Warehouse Co., Ltd. on the same day.
In executive roles, several promotions and reassignments took place. Notably, Takayuki Suzuki was promoted to Deputy Managing Officer of Management Division and concurrently appointed as Deputy Manager of Corporate Planning Department. Other notable changes included Hideyuki Kobayashi moving to Deputy Managing Officer of Management Division and Manager of Business Division, Tomu Nihashi becoming Executive Officer responsible for Internal Audit Room, and Naohiko Yokoyama taking on the role of Deputy Managing Officer of Sales Division and concurrently serving as Manager of Sales Strategy Office. Nihashi is also slated to concurrently serve as Vice President of Ensuzu Truck Kansai Co., Ltd. starting June 25, 2026.
Further adjustments involve Koshi Okano being reassigned from West Japan Business Division Chief to Head of Headquarters Business Division, Keigo Nose moving from West Japan Business Division Chief to Assistant to Headquarters Business Division Chief, and Hiromasa Iwamoto transitioning from Advisor to Head of Internal Audit Room.
